The Green Bay Packers are not expected to receive a compensatory pick in the 2026 draft after signing guard Aaron Banks and cornerback Nate Hobbs, which offset their free agency losses. While other NFC North teams like the Vikings and Lions are projected to gain several compensatory picks, the Packers’ signings disqualified them from receiving any compensation for their departed players.

The Vikings have the biggest draft screwup nobody talks about
Safety Lewis Cine was released by the Philadelphia Eagles, marking the end of a disappointing three-year NFL career that began with high expectations after being drafted by the Vikings. The Vikings' decision to trade down in the 2022 draft, missing out on top safety Kyle Hamilton, has been criticized as a significant blunder, with their subsequent picks yielding little success.
